Situated in the heart of the charming town of Linlithgow, just 20 miles west of Edinburgh, Linlithgow train station serves as a key gateway to a wealth of Scottish locales. Whether you're a local heading into the city for work, a student, or a traveler exploring Scotland, the station offers a blend of essential amenities and convenient transport links to make your journey smooth and enjoyable.
The station is equipped with a ticket office that operates from early morning until late at night, ensuring that you can always secure a ticket for your travels. For those who prefer online booking, ticket collection is facilitated by accessible ticket machines located at the station. Moreover, for passengers with hearing impairments, an induction loop is available, enhancing accessibility.
Independently navigating the station is straightforward due to the comprehensive step-free access provided throughout. Despite having no accessible toilets, the station offers waiting rooms on both platforms where travelers can also access public Wi-Fi. If you're looking to grab a quick refreshment, a coffee vending machine is on hand to cater to your caffeine needs before you embark on your journey.
Linlithgow station boasts substantial connectivity with various modes of transport ensuring seamless travel. Should railway services be disrupted, a rail replacement service operates with buses picking up passengers from High Street. For detailed information about bus services, visit Traveline Scotland or call their 24-hour hotline. Taxi services are equally accessible, with details available at TrainTaxi.
Parking is hassle-free with a no-charge policy, as there are 96 parking spaces available, inclusive of two blue badge spaces. Cyclists are also catered to with a covered bicycle storage area accommodating up to 38 bikes, protected by CCTV for enhanced security.

Whether you're a seasoned traveler hopping from city to city or someone planning a casual trip, Hillington West train station offers a delightful starting point for your journey. Nestled close to Glasgow in Scotland, this station is a gateway to exciting destinations, making travel both convenient and enjoyable. With easy access to various transport links and an array of nearby attractions, Hillington West is a great stop on your rail travel itinerary.
For those planning to buy tickets at the station, the ticket office at Hillington West operates from 07:10 to 14:14 on weekdays and Saturdays, although it's closed on Sundays. No need to worry about buying your tickets in advance since ticket machines are available and can also assist with the collection of tickets purchased online. The station supports accessible travel with step-free access and induction loops. However, be cautious as the stepping distance between train and platform is slightly larger at some points.
One must note that there are some facilities that you might miss at Hillington West. The station does not have toilets, baby changing facilities, refreshment services, or Wi-Fi on-site. Furthermore, accessibility support includes help points, and a notable absence of waiting rooms, accessible toilets, or accessible taxis. For those cycling, there are bicycle stands, albeit without shelters or CCTV coverage.
Once you alight at Hillington West, moving to your next destination is straightforward. The station provides a bus stop pickup and drop-off on Queen Elizabeth Avenue, making it simple to catch a bus. For updated bus service details, visiting Travel Line Scotland online or calling their 24-hour service is recommended. Taxis can also be arranged via Train Taxi, offering another convenient travel option.
